Respondent, a township volunteer fire company, was subject to the Right-to-Know Law where the evidence regarding the degree of governmental control, the nature of respondent's functions and financial control supported a finding that it was a "local agency" for the purposes of that law. The court ordered a response to petitioner's request.

Parents moved for judgment on the administrative record and court found district erred in placing child in local public school because the placement directly contradicted expert's recommendation, district and parents had an enforceable agreement to send child to the expert-recommended school and the equities supported full tuition reimbursement. Motion granted.

The defendant company was liable for a judgment confessed against its predecessor under the "mere continuation" exception to the general rule on successor liability where the evidence made it clear that the defendant company was a mere continuation of the original business. The court granted plaintiff's motion for summary judgment.
